Sr. Quality Engineer (NJ) - Japanese Bilingual Preferred (Springfield, NJ)
SUMMARY
Possesses an excellent understanding of quality engineering fundamentals and applies knowledge of company policies and procedures to assess and analyze product quality performance of wireless products. Able to work independently to research and determine root cause of electrical, mechanical, RF and software problems with fielded units. Provides timely professional details and summaries of findings.
REQUIREMENTS
- 5+ years quality engineering fundamentals either by a formal four year technical degree (or higher, e.g., BSEE, BSME, MSEE, BSME) or by significant accumulated experience – ASQ Certified Quality Engineer or similar credential preferred
- 3+ years experience with wireless handset troubleshooting in design and/or repair
- Good working technical knowledge of how cellular phones interoperate with network infrastructure
- Proficient in MS Office applications. Strong grasp of Excel formulas, macros and spreadsheet interfaces. Ability to generate and interpret graphical reports.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Ability to distill raw data into key trend and pareto reports
- Ability to clearly present data
- Japanese-English bilingual highly preferred
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
- Devises and implements methods and procedures for inspecting, testing, and evaluating performance of wireless products
- Designs or specifies inspection and testing mechanisms and equipment; conducts quality assurance tests; and performs statistical analysis to assess the cost of and determine the responsibility for, products or materials that do not meet required standards and specifications
- Provides recommended solutions to manufacturer/supplier issues such as improving yields and reducing costs
- Learns how to use test tools (software and hardware) and help other team members with it
- Helps brainstorm solutions to problems by interpreting analysis results
- Runs field tests to duplicate customer product issues
- Uses resourcefulness with carriers and retail sales channel to very rapidly obtain product performance feedback immediately after new product launches
- Performs quality inspections to ensure high quality of carrier lab submission units
- Provides useful feedback in reviewing process manuals, etc
- Performs other related activities as needed
PROBLEM SOLVING
- Works on problems of large scope where analysis of situations or data requires a review of a variety of factors
- Exercises judgment within defined procedures and practices to determine appropriate action
- Builds productive working relationships internally and externally
- Demonstrates mastery of field failure rate estimation and measurement
